Tar roof replacement services involve removing the existing roof covering and installing a new roofing system on a property. This process typically includes inspecting the underlying structure, preparing the surface, and carefully installing new roofing materials to ensure durability and performance. The goal is to restore the roof's integrity, improve its lifespan, and enhance the overall appearance of the building. Professionals handling tar roof replacements often work with various types of roofing materials suited to the specific needs of the property and local climate conditions.

These services are often sought to address issues such as extensive roof damage, persistent leaks, or deterioration caused by age and weather exposure. Over time, tar roofs can develop cracks, blisters, or areas of wear that compromise their effectiveness. Replacing the roof helps prevent water intrusion, structural damage, and mold growth, which can lead to costly repairs if left unaddressed. A new roof also provides peace of mind by ensuring the property remains protected from the elements for years to come.

Commercial properties frequently utilize tar roof replacement services due to the durability and cost-effectiveness of this roofing method for large-scale structures. Warehouses, industrial facilities, and retail buildings often have flat or low-slope roofs that are ideal for tar-based systems. Additionally, some residential buildings with flat or low-slope roofs may opt for tar roof replacement to maintain their property's integrity and appearance. The process can be adapted to different property sizes and configurations, making it a versatile option for various property types.

Cost Range - The typical cost for a tar roof replacement varies between $4,000 and $10,000,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Smaller residential projects tend to be on the lower end, while larger or more intricate roofs may cost more.

Material and Labor - Material costs for tar roofing usually range from $1.50 to $3.50 per square foot, with labor charges adding to the overall expense. For example, a 1,500-square-foot roof might cost approximately $3,000 to $5,250 for materials and labor combined.

Factors Influencing Cost - The total expense can be affected by roof accessibility, existing roof condition, and local labor rates. Additional features such as flashing or insulation upgrades may also increase the overall price.

Cost Variability - Prices for tar roof replacement services can vary significantly based on geographic location and contractor pricing. Contact local service providers to obtain accurate estimates tailored to specific project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should a tar roof be replaced? The lifespan of a tar roof typically ranges from 15 to 20 years, but replacement timing depends on factors like weather, maintenance, and roof condition. Consulting local roofing contractors can help determine when a replacement is needed.

What signs indicate a tar roof needs replacement? Signs include extensive cracking, blistering, widespread granule loss, and persistent leaks. An inspection by a roofing professional can assess whether replacement is advisable.

Are there different types of tar roof replacement options? Yes, options include complete removal and replacement, or overlaying a new layer over the existing roof, depending on the roof’s condition and local building codes. A local service provider can advise on suitable solutions.

How long does a tar roof replacement typically take? The duration varies based on the size and complexity of the roof, but most replacements can be completed within a few days. A local contractor can provide a more specific timeline after inspection.
